PRESENTERS:

Cammi Granato and Ray Ferraro, moderated by Dan Murphy
"Beyond the Ice: Cammi Granato's and Ray Ferraro's Journeys in Sports Management & Media"

Cammi Granato - is a hockey legend who serves as an Assistant General Manager for the Vancouver Canucks. Granato captained the U.S. Women's Hockey Team that won a gold medal at the 1998 Olympics. She is a member of the IIHF Hall of Fame, the US Hockey Hall of Fame and the Hockey Hall of Fame.

Ray Ferraro - is a former NHL star who serves as a broadcaster for ESPN/ABC and CBC Sports/Sportsnet. Ferraro won the 1983 Memorial Cup with the Portland Winterhawks. Ferraro's prolific NHL career saw him score 898 points in 1,258 games across 18 seasons.

Dan Murphy - is a sportscaster who hosts Vancouver Canucks broadcasts on Rogers Sportsnet, as well as Hockey Night in Canada. Murphy is the co-author of the novel Journeyman with Sean Pronger, and hosts the Don't Change Much Podcast.

Dr. Tyler Standifird
"Leveraging Ground Reaction Forces: Practical Tools for the Teaching Tee"

Dr. Tyler Standifird is a Professor of Biomechanics in the Exercise Science Department at Utah Valley University. His research centers around force and motion capture data of various sports, including golf. Dr. Standifird leads one of America's premier biomechanics golf labs. As a professor and researcher, he has collaborated with leading golf organizations to advance understanding of swing mechanics and player development.

Angus Reid
"What It Really Takes to Achieve Sustainable Success"

Angus Reid is a former CFL offensive lineman who played 14 seasons for the BC Lions. Reid played for the Simon Fraser University football team, but health issues related to Crohn's Disease paused his career. He revived his passion for football when he received an opportunity to play for the Hamburg Blue Devils in Germany, parlaying that opportunity into a path to the CFL. Reid won two Grey Cups during his time with the Lions. He now serves as a motivational speaker and high-energy storyteller.

Dr. Katie Lebel
"Driving Change: Inspiring the Next Generation of Women Golfers"

Dr. Katie Lebel is a Sports Business Professor at the Gordon S. Lang School of Business and Economics at the University of Guelph. Dr. Lebel's research examines the sport business landscape with a focus on gender equity, sport fandom, marketing, and communications. Her current work is exploring opportunities for innovative disruption in sport and the development of a new sport business model with projects related to next gen sport fans, women's sport fans, and sport retail. Dr. Lebel is an affiliated scholar at the Tucker Center for Research on Girls & Women in Sport, she sits on the Scientific Committee for the National Network for Research on Gender Equity in Canadian Sport, and is a founding scholar of the The Collective at Wasserman.

 

Rick Fehr
"Bad Instruction Ruined My Playing Career... And Made Me a Better Coach"

Rick is a two-time PGA TOUR winner who draws from over 30 years of success as both a player and coach to provide results-driven performance coaching for his clients.

Recognized by Golf Digest as one of the Best Teachers in the state of Washington, Rick continues to pursue coaching expertise with the same passion and dedication once employed to become a multiple winner on the PGA TOUR. When Rick is not working with a client, he is likely off diving deeper into an exciting aspect of human performance in order to more effectively coach the players he works with.

As a former TOUR player, Rick knew that his playing experience alone would not be enough for him to become a highly effective coach. Therefore, he continues to learn from and collaborate with other top coaches, attend workshops and seminars, pursue expertise in a broad variety of subjects, and apply the principles to his holistic approach.

Golfers will find that Rick’s coaching style favors the principles of simplicity and self-discovery, while being undergirded by the latest science of movement and peak performance.

Alan Oishi

"Understanding the Growth Journey"

Speaker: Alan Oishi - TEC Canada

Since 2010, Alan Oishi has been providing strategic advisory services to purpose-led organizations across a diverse range of industries. He is also a highly regarded speaker with over 100 engagements. Alan empowers leaders and their teams to improve strategic decision making, strengthen alignment, and achieve sustainable growth. He provides support through strategy offsites, projects, learning programs, and key note presentations.

Prior to his transition to strategic advisory services, Alan spent 18 years at Colliers International, where he held leadership roles including serving as Executive Vice President, Global Chief Operating Officer, and Chief Executive, USA.

Aileen McManamon

"Green is the New Black: Creating Win-Win, Sustainable Scenarios for the Golf Industry"

Aileen McManamon | Sustainable Innovation In Sport

Aileen McManamon is the Founder and Managing Partner of 5T Sports Group, a global sports management firm and certified B Corp. 5T focuses on futureproofing the sports industry by aligning team and league revenue models to the environmental, social and economic realities of today.

Aileen’s career began in the European auto industry with FIAT and Alfa Romeo, crafting marketing strategy and top-performing partnerships between Fortune 500 brands and sports properties and directing the firm’s national spend. Returning to North America after 5 years in Germany and focusing on the rapidly emerging tech sector, she guided international business strategy for clients in IT, wireless, enterprise software and clean tech.

Craving a return to sports, Aileen had her ‘cup of coffee’ running the Oakland A’s minor league affiliate team in Vancouver, followed by founding 5T Sports Group where she parlayed her brand marketing and technology expertise into working with the Olympic Games, FIFA Women’s World Cup, MLB, MLS, MiLB and the NFL, and brands such as Microsoft, EA Games, Hewlett-Packard and Mercedes-Benz. In addition to 5T, Aileen serves as the Board Chair of the Green Sports Alliance and on the boards of the Sports Ecology Group and Equal Play FC.
